Inside the Geezers Studio

Newsweek, June, 2008

In their first YouTube film review, for last year’s high-school hit “Superbad,” octogenarian Hollywood vets Marcia Nasatir and Lorenzo Semple bicker about which dirty words are most offensive—and repeat them, over and over. The Reel Geezers began as a gimmick, but now has a dedicated Web following that includes many Hollywood insiders. The critical duo spoke with NEWSWEEK’s Jesse Ellison:

How did you start doing this?

SEMPLE: Marcia and I were arguing at a dinner party—

NASATIR: No, it’s called a frank discussion.

SEMPLE: It was so frank and loud that one guest got up and said, “You two ought to shut up and put your show on the road.” So it occurred to me that, well, maybe we should.
